whenever i try to install anything on Ubuntu 8.04 i get this error

dpkg: parse error, in file `/var/lib/dpkg/status' near line 26071 package `ekiga':
`Depends' field, reference to `libice6': version contains ` '
E: Sub-process /usr/bin/dpkg returned an error code (2)

Another option could be to replace /var/lib/dpkg/status with /var/lib/dpkg/status-old

sudo mv /var/lib/dpkg/status /var/lib/dpkg/status-broke

sudo cp /var/lib/dpkg/status-old /var/lib/dpkg/status
